Check Digit Verification of cas no

The CAS Registry Mumber 29883-16-7 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 2,9,8,8 and 3 respectively; the second part has 2 digits, 1 and 6 respectively.
Calculate Digit Verification of CAS Registry Number 29883-16:
(7*2)+(6*9)+(5*8)+(4*8)+(3*3)+(2*1)+(1*6)=157
157 % 10 = 7
So 29883-16-7 is a valid CAS Registry Number.

Synthesis and Biological Evaluation of Cyanogenic Glycosides

Yashunsky, Dmitry V.,Kulakovskaya, Ekaterina V.,Kulakovskaya, Tatiana V.,Zhukova, Olga S.,Kiselevskiy, Mikhail V.,Nifantiev, Nikolay E.

, p. 460 - 474 (2015/12/23)

An efficient procedure for the synthesis of cyanogenic glycosides with different carbohydrate units was developed. Amygdalin (3), prunasin (1), sambunigrin (2), and neoamygdalin (21) were prepared according to the elaborated method, and biological tests, including antifungal, antibacterial, and cytotoxic activities, were performed.
